Carolyn Presley Discusses the Burden of Curative Lung Cancer Treatment
Author(s)Carolyn Presley
Carolyn Presley, clinical fellow, geriatric oncology, Yale Cancer Center, Robert Wood Johnson Clinical Scholar, discusses a study looking at the burden of health care on patients undergoing curative lung cancer care.
